The dynamics have changed inside the households of two St Kilda backmen since the end of last season.
Key defender Nathan Brown and rebounding half-back Shane Savage have both welcomed daughters in recent months, growing their family from one child to two, shifting the dynamics in the process.
Brown, 29, and his wife, Liana, added another girl to their growing family in December, providing daughter Billie with a little sister, Farah.
“We had another girl, Farah,” Brown told saints.com.au at St Kilda’s pre-season camp at Geelong Grammar last week.

Days after St Kilda’s season finished in August, Savage and his wife, Sarah, brought Willow into the world, ensuring the dashing defender’s off-season was significantly different to almost all of his teammates.
“It’s been amazing. I love being a Dad,” Savage said.
“Every time I get home they just make me so happy and make me switch off from footy. I love playing around with them.”
Not to miss out on the party, St Kilda skipper Jarryn Geary and his fiancée, Emma, had their first child earlier this month.
